Suppose that the mean systolic blood pressure for women over age seventy is 134 mmHg (millimeters of mercury), with a standard d
IceJOKER [234]

Answer:

See below for answers (in bold) and explanations

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Part A</u>

According to the Empirical Rule, 99.7% of the data in a normal distribution are ±3σ standard deviations away from the mean. Hence, approximately 99.7% of women over seventy have blood pressures between 134-3σ = 134-3(7) = 134-21 = 113 mmHg and 134+3σ = 134+3(7) = 134+21 = 155 mmHg.

<u>Part B</u>

As 141-134=134-127=7, this represents ±1σ standard deviations away from the mean of 134 mmHg, which corresponds to 68% of the data by the Empirical Rule. Hence, approximately 68% of women over seventy have blood pressures between 127 mmHg and 141 mmHg
